Internal Memo — New Subscription Tier

To all branch managers. Effective next quarter, we are introducing the Meridian Plus tier, positioned between the standard and premium offerings. It bundles priority servicing and the Fernhall rewards program at a mid-range price point. Training materials arrive in two weeks; do not discuss pricing with customers before launch. The rationale behind the timing appears in the confidential note below.

confidential, hahop-bajep: Gross margin on Ralath came in at 5 percent against a plan of 10 percent. Only 9 of the 100 pilot accounts renewed Ralath, so a churn review is set for April 1.

**CI note: timezone weirdness in report exports**

Heads up, support folks — if a customer says their Ledgerpine export shows times shifted by a few hours, it's probably the CI image. The export workers got rebuilt last week and the base image defaults to UTC, while older workers used the account's locale. Fix is rolling out; meanwhile tell customers the data itself is fine, just the display offset. Affected exports carry the build token shown below.

build token for bajof-tahop: htk4_a981

Handover Note — Branch Managers

Folks, as I hand the Merrivale portfolio to Dominic, a heads-up on the ongoing licensing dispute with Quillhart Systems. They claim our Fenlight module infringes their scheduling patent; our counsel disagrees, but mediation starts next month. Until then, don't discuss Fenlight roadmaps with Quillhart resellers, and route any of their enquiries to Dominic directly. He has the full file and settlement parameters. The wider plan is outlined below.

board note of yadup-fajef: Druiusox Holdings is in early talks to buy Norwynek Systems for about $186.0 million. The Kaseth launch date is June 24, and nothing goes to the press before then. Legal wants the Quenethek Group term sheet withdrawn before November 27.

Migration step 3: swap the renderer

Okay folks, next step for the Twinevine graph visualizer migration: we're retiring the old canvas renderer and moving everyone to the WebGL one. Flip the feature flag per tenant, watch the edge-count dashboard for anything above 50k nodes, and roll back if frame times spike. The Delmora team already migrated and it went fine. Do this during low traffic. Once the flag is flipped, the renderer reads its tuning from the block below.

deployment values, kajep-kageg:
[praix]
host = praix.paliqcorp.corp
user = praix_svc
database = praix_prod